The Balanced Budget Act of 1997 established the Medicare Payment Advisory Commission (MedPAC) and gave the Comptroller General responsibility for appointing its members. For appointments to MedPAC that will be effective May 1, 2016, I am announcing the following: Letters of nomination and resumes will be accepted through March 9, 2016 to ensure adequate opportunity for review and consideration of nominees prior to appointment of new members. Acknowledgement of submissions will be provided within a week of submission. Please contact Mary Giffin at (202) 512-3710 if you do not receive an acknowledgment.
